FCC: Affordable Connectivity Program

Notice of final rule from the Federal Communications Commission (FCC) adopting rules to establish enhanced discounts available for monthly broadband services provided in high-cost areas by participants in the Affordable Connectivity Program (ACP). The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act directed the FCC to make available a high-cost area benefit through participating providers of up to $75 per month for broadband internet access service in certain areas where the cost of building broadband facilities is relatively high. This rule is effective October 2, 2023.
